Stardust Amber Sugar Jewelry Box ~Gifts from the Sparkling Universe
Inspired by “ET Day” on December 4, the mystery and sparkle of the universe is expressed in amber sugar, an edible jewel that looks great on social media. The contrast between the crunchy texture when you put it in your mouth and the melted texture when you swallow it is a special sweet that stimulates all five senses.
Ingredients (easy-to-make portions)
| Material name | amount |
|---|---|
| granulated sugar | 250g |
| water (esp. cool, fresh water, e.g. drinking water) | 100ml |
| agar-agar | 4g |
| Food coloring (blue, purple, pink, or other color of your choice) | small quantity |
| Alazan (star or pearl shaped) | proper quantity |
| Flavoring (lemon juice, vanilla essence, etc.) | Small amount to taste |
way of making
- Step 1: Build the foundation of the universe.Place water and agar agar powder in a saucepan, mix well, and bring to a boil over medium heat. When it comes to a boil, reduce the heat to low and continue stirring for 1-2 minutes until the agar powder is completely dissolved. The key is not to be impatient here.
- [Step 2: Birth of a sweet star.When the powdered agar is dissolved, add the granulated sugar all at once and stir until dissolved. When the mixture becomes transparent and slightly thickened, turn off the heat. This is an important process that determines the brilliance of the amber sugar.
- Step 3: Galactic coloring.Divide the resulting agar liquid into several heatproof containers, add a small amount of food coloring to each and mix well. Try to adjust the shade of color for a gradation. You can also add lemon juice or vanilla essence to taste.
- [Step 4: Sprinkle with twinkling stardust.Pour the agar liquid of each color into a flat bat or mold (a plastic container is also OK), and gently spread it out so as not to mix the colors too much. For a more cosmic effect, pour in several colors at random to create a marbled pattern! Sprinkle some arazine to create sparkling stardust.
- [Step 5: Wait quietly for the right moment.Allow to cool and harden at room temperature for 30 minutes to 1 hour. Although it will solidify faster if placed in the refrigerator, room temperature is recommended because sudden temperature changes may prevent crystallization on the surface.
- Step 6: Cut out the gemstone.When completely hardened, remove from the mold and cut into desired shapes with a knife. Cut freely into dice, rhombuses, irregular crystal shapes, etc., to enrich the expression of the “jewel”. The sound of the clacking sound when cutting is also a joy that only handmade jewelry can bring.
- Step 7: The Magic of DryingPlace the cut amber sugar on a cookie sheet lined bat and let it dry in a well-ventilated place. This is the magic process that produces the best part of amber sugar, the crunchy outside and the pulled texture inside! The drying period is about 2 to 7 days. When the surface becomes white and crystallized, it is a sign of completion. Don’t be in a hurry, but check on it every day.
This is the secret to good taste!
The contrasting textures of the crispy outside and the soft and pliable inside are the charm of amber sugar. In particular, do not rush the drying process, but take your time in a well-ventilated place. Also, the key is to add food coloring in small amounts to find the desired shade.
